      <description>&lt;P&gt;What lens do you currently have. It should be one of the many variants of the EF-S 18-55mm lenses. If so please post the full model name of the lens. Also what is your budget for a new lens. Are you doing your work indoors or outdoors. If your doing your work indoors it will be challenging with your current lens to freeze action. Due to the lens having a slow aperture. All versions of the EF-S 18-55mm are variable aperture lenses. The widest open aperture is usually F/3.5-5.6 with most versions. The newest STM variant (version 2) is even slower at F/4-5.6 which allows less light to the camera. With variable aperture lenses the more you zoom in the less light enters in the camera. For instance at 18mm the widest available aperture is F/3.5 but at the longest focal length of 55mm the widest available aperture is F/5.6 which is slow for indoor shooting.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
